God is Good

“For God So loved the world that he Gave his one and only son, that whoever believes in him shall not perish but have eternal life. For God did not send his son in to the world to condemn the world, but to save the world through him.” John 3:16&17. NIV

“For the wages of sin is death, but the gift of God is eternal life in Christ Jesus our Lord.” Romans’ 6:23. NIV

These passages speak of the love God has for everyone. He soooo loves us not just when we are good or do what he wants. But everyone and all the time. He does not want anyone ever to perish. He wants to save the whole world. He gave us his one and only son to be born just so he would be condemned to die a horrible humiliating death so nobody else would ever have to die.

That is love. He is a perfect and holy God who can not dwell among sin. They made a way for us to live with them in paradise forever. But they also gave us free will to choose what we want. They have made it very clear what they want. They have given us their words written out for all to discover.

Even if something is Gods will, and it is the very best thing for us, he will not force it on us. It is totally our free will to decide on our own. By doing nothing and making no decision we have decided the answer is no. “I do not want your gift God.” Even though saying yes has made me happier than I can ever imagine. At one time in my life I said yes.

They have given us a gift. Just like every gift you have ever been given it is free. You have to do nothing but accept it. It takes faith to accept it because it is not something we can see or feel. We have to believe we have it. With that gift comes the promise of their help. This is not all us but we have help.

Once we believe we need to practice what we believe and turn away from sin. We are no longer a slave to sin and the way to death but are made new. Many people choose to believe the parts of the Bible that they like. It is historically accurate and has been proven to be true. If it is true it is to be believed. All of it.

If we believe all the good things like how much God knows us and loves us. Knowing our every thought and always wanting what is best for us. Then we ought to believe when he tells us what not to do. Sin is not just wrong it is not good for us if it brings our eternal death. He has warned us time and time again. But this is one thing he doesn’t have control over.

We do though. So nobody can say that a righteous God would not send someone to hell. He doesn’t. We do by not believing and obeying. We have the final say over our actions. We can use any excuse we want but not doing his will puts it on us not him. He is a very loving and just God.

He tells us in his word how to be blessed. He tells us how to live a full and abundant life. How to have fullness of joy. Bubbling over in our lives. He wants what every good father wants for his children. The best. Every good parent will do everything they can to see their children happy, healthy, and safe. They will discipline them and at times say no if what they want is not best for them.

They don’t serve ice cream for breakfast and candy for lunch. If we ate like that we wouldn’t live to see our teens. Running free in the streets is not allowed because it’s not safe. We expect those things even though eating our veggies is a drag we want to be healthy. So we do things we dislike.

Shouldn’t we be glad to do things that bring joy, happiness, and blessings. We want a good happy life? Right.
